Nitrogen Purification Process
The CMS quickly adsorbs oxygen gas from compressed air, making pure nitrogen gas available at the outlet. Once the entire bed reaches an equilibrium state, it requires regeneration. During this process, oxygen molecules are released from the bed, preparing it for another cycle of impurity adsorption and pure nitrogen release. The CMS here shows a particular attraction towards the Oxygen molecules. Therefore, Oxygen molecules are absorbed by the Carbon Molecular Sieve, while Nitrogen is unable to be absorbed.
